Output 124586ad56f512d261b6231bf300f5c84cfe6d5d83e286e3180650d3cbaaa951:93

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9b18a5d787c0b88a7f2e256c4acc25b389bd3f9c7c33542f818eae7ad2a183a5
address
bc1pnvv2t4u8czug5lewy4ky4np9kwym60uu0se4gtup36h8454pswjscaltf4
transaction
124586ad56f512d261b6231bf300f5c84cfe6d5d83e286e3180650d3cbaaa951
spent
true